Roof waterproofing services involve applying specialized coatings or membranes to a roof’s surface to prevent water infiltration. This process helps create a protective barrier that shields the underlying structure from moisture damage caused by rain, snow, or humidity. The materials used in waterproofing can include liquid coatings, sheet membranes, or sealants, all designed to enhance the roof’s resistance to water penetration. Professional contractors assess the roof’s condition and select the appropriate waterproofing solution to ensure long-lasting protection tailored to the specific type of roof and its exposure to the elements.

Waterproofing services address common issues such as leaks, mold growth, and structural deterioration resulting from water intrusion. Over time, roofs can develop cracks, blisters, or worn-out areas that compromise their ability to keep water out. Waterproofing helps mitigate these problems by sealing vulnerable spots and preventing moisture from seeping into the building. This proactive approach can reduce the likelihood of costly repairs, interior water damage, and the development of mold or mildew, ultimately extending the lifespan of the roof and maintaining the integrity of the property.

Material Costs - The cost of waterproofing materials typically ranges from $1.50 to $4.00 per square foot, depending on the type and quality used. For a standard residential roof, this can translate to $1,500 to $4,000 for materials alone. Prices vary based on product selection and roof size.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for roof waterproofing services generally fall between $2.00 and $5.00 per square foot. For an average home, this could amount to $2,000 to $5,000, depending on the complexity of the project. Factors such as roof height and accessibility influence labor rates.

Project Size and Scope - Larger or more complex roofs tend to incur higher costs, with projects exceeding 2,000 square feet often reaching $4,000 to $8,000. Smaller or straightforward jobs may be completed for less, typically around $1,500 to $3,000. The specific scope impacts overall expenses significantly.

Additional Costs - Extra services such as surface preparation, repairs, or additional waterproofing layers can add $500 to $2,000 to the total cost. These expenses depend on the condition of the existing roof and the extent of necessary work. Contact local pros for det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of waterproofing? Roof waterproofing involves applying materials or systems to protect a roof from water infiltration, helping to prevent leaks and water damage.

How do I know if my roof needs waterproofing? Signs such as persistent leaks, water stains, or damaged roofing materials may indicate the need for waterproofing services from local contractors.

What types of waterproofing methods are available? Common methods include liquid coatings, membrane systems, and sealants, which can be selected based on the roof type and condition.

How long does roof waterproofing typically last? The longevity of waterproofing depends on the materials used and local conditions, but professional applications often last several years before maintenance is needed.
